My name is Zakk, I am from the band Eulogy from Davis CA. We have dedicated the past year of our lives to independently recording and producing our first full-length album by the title of "Alpha Omega". The album is our attempt to bring back some of the old school maiden/priest sound while infusing elements of epic power metal and faster thrash metal at the same time.
